Here is a video of a massive crash between Mike Conway & Ryan Hunter Reay in the last lap at the Indianapolis 2010. Dario Franchitti won the race.

The last report on his condition I heard was that “Mike Conway is awake, alert and is being taken to Methodist Hospital with an orthopedic leg injury”

After watching this crash video, I’d say he was pretty lucky to get away with only minor injuries.
